Abstract
A mixer for a confluent-flow nozzle of a turbine engine is provided. The mixer includes: an annular cap designed to be centered on a longitudinal axis of the nozzle and having a stationary upstream portion and a downstream portion that is movable in rotation about the longitudinal axis relative to the stationary portion, the movable portion of the cap terminating at its downstream end in inner lobes alternating circumferentially with outer lobes; and a mechanism which imparts reciprocating rotary motion to the movable portion of the cap.
